DR: Disaster Recovery

Disaster recovery (DR) refers to the processes, strategies, and technologies put in place by organizations to ensure the continuity and quick restoration of critical IT systems and business operations in the event of a disaster or disruptive event. It involves comprehensive planning, preparation, and execution of recovery procedures to minimize the impact of a disaster on the organization’s ability to function.

Overview:

In today’s technology-driven world, organizations heavily rely on their IT systems to support their daily operations and deliver essential services. However, disasters such as natural calamities, cyber-attacks, hardware failures, or even human errors can disrupt these systems and halt business activities. Disaster recovery provides a structured approach to mitigate the effects of such events, allowing organizations to swiftly recover and resume normal operations.

Advantages:

Implementing a robust disaster recovery plan offers numerous advantages to organizations, including:

  1. Business Continuity: By having an effective DR plan in place, organizations can ensure uninterrupted business operations, minimizing downtime and reducing financial losses associated with system outages.
  2. Data Protection: Disaster recovery solutions enable the regular backup and replication of critical data, ensuring its availability even in the face of a disaster. This safeguards valuable information, preventing data loss and supporting compliance with regulatory requirements.
  3. Customer Confidence: When organizations can quickly recover from a disaster, they demonstrate their ability to deliver uninterrupted services to customers. This builds trust, enhances customer satisfaction, and safeguards the organization’s reputation.
  4. Cost Savings: Although the implementation of a disaster recovery plan requires initial investment, it proves cost-effective in the long run. The potential financial losses resulting from extended downtimes and data breaches far outweigh the costs associated with planning and implementing a robust recovery strategy.

Applications:

Disaster recovery finds application across various sectors, including:

  1. Financial Institutions: Banks and other financial institutions rely heavily on their IT infrastructure to carry out transactions, process payments, and provide online services. Disaster recovery is crucial in the financial sector to ensure the reliability and availability of these services, protect customer data, and maintain regulatory compliance.
  2. Healthcare: Healthtech relies on seamless access to patient records, medical imaging systems, and critical healthcare applications. Disaster recovery is vital to ensure uninterrupted access to patient data, maintain healthcare services, and safeguard sensitive patient information.
  3. E-commerce: Online businesses need continuous access to their websites, customer databases, and payment gateways. Disaster recovery helps prevent revenue loss resulting from website downtime, maintain customer trust, and protect sensitive customer information.

Conclusion:

Disaster recovery is a critical aspect of IT operations, aiming to minimize the impact of disruptive events on organizational functions. By implementing effective strategies, organizations can ensure business continuity, protect critical data, enhance customer confidence, and achieve significant cost savings. With the increasing reliance on technology, investing in robust disaster recovery plans has become a necessity to mitigate risks and enable rapid recovery in the face of unforeseen disasters.
